The Low-Key Poke Joint
Poke bowl with hot cheetos from Low-Key Poke JointLow-key Poke Joint Hot Cheetos sushirrito
Images via Yelp

With locations in RiversideLoma Linda and Garden Grove, this next spot is a little of a drive away from Pomona, but it’s definitely worth the mileage. And while it might be called The Low-Key Poke Joint, this place is far from low-key with more than 2,000 combined reviews on Yelp. Here you’ll have the option to create your own poke bowl with Hot Cheeto crumbs sprinkled on top or you can try their famous Hot Cheeto poke burrito (aka Sushirrito) that is dusted with those notoriously red crumbs. In addition to their fiery toppings, they’re known for their extremely fresh fish and generous portions, so this spot is a must-try for any poke fan.

BionicLand
 Hot elotes and esquites with hot cheetos
Image via Yelp

Continuing with the corn and Hot Cheetos theme, this next place serves what you might call Mexican corn on the cob. The classic version of this dish is a buttered corn on the cob with mayo, cotija cheese and sprinkled chili powder. BionicLand has added a twist to the classic dish and upped their game by coating their corn with Hot Cheetos. And once you top it off with a freshly squeezed lime, you’re good to go. But if you’re not in the mood to get your face dirty with all that bright red dust—because we already know what it does to your fingers—you can always opt to have your corn shaved into a cup (as pictured above).
